When an individual has rehabilitated from a drug or alcohol addiction, it's not as easy as resuming where you left off. Restoring a successful and happy life takes time and a great deal of effort. A Halfway House, a.k.a. a Sober Living Facility, is an environment where people in recovery can live in a clean and healthy setting until they are able to live stably on their own. Living in a Halfway House may be a term of a person's probation for example, or someone could decide to live in a Halfway House of their own will following drug or alcohol rehab. In either case, occupants of a Halfway House are clean and sober and working towards doing what is necessary to get their lives back on track. This could mean, for example, finishing school, getting a job, etc.

Halfway Houses in Bristolville are managed by people who in most cases were once tenants of the house. How long an individual is permitted to remain at the Halfway House will differ, but it's typically anywhere from a month to a couple of years. Occupants are required to submit to alcohol and drug testing prior to being accepted into the house, and this testing will continue intermittently to make sure there isn't any drug use in the house or substance abuse problems that would be more adequately dealt with in a drug or alcohol rehabilitation program.
